Baidu, often referred to as the "Google of China," is a leading technology company with a significant presence in the rapidly expanding field of cloud computing. While less internationally known than its American counterparts, Baidu's cloud services, branded as Baidu Cloud (百度云计算), are a critical infrastructure component for businesses and individuals across China, powering a diverse range of applications and services. This article delves into the intricacies of Baidu Cloud, examining its offerings, market position, technological strengths, and challenges in a competitive landscape.

Baidu Cloud's offerings are comprehensive, mirroring the breadth of services provided by major global cloud providers like AWS and Azure. It provides a robust suite of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S), Platform-as-a-Service (PaaS), and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) solutions. Its IaaS offerings include virtual machines (VMs), storage solutions (object storage, block storage, file storage), and networking capabilities, enabling businesses to build and manage their IT infrastructure efficiently in the cloud. Baidu Cloud's PaaS offerings focus on providing development platforms and tools, allowing developers to quickly build, deploy, and manage applications without the complexities of managing underlying infrastructure. This includes services for containerization (Kubernetes), serverless computing, and machine learning.

One of Baidu Cloud's key differentiators is its strong integration with Baidu's other core technologies, particularly in artificial intelligence (AI). Baidu is a pioneer in AI research and development, and this expertise is deeply embedded within its cloud offerings. Developers and businesses can leverage Baidu's powerful AI tools and APIs, including natural language processing (NLP), computer vision, and deep learning frameworks, directly within their cloud-based applications. This integration provides a significant advantage, offering a streamlined and efficient pathway for businesses to incorporate AI into their workflows and products.

Baidu's AI capabilities are particularly valuable in several key sectors. In the healthcare industry, Baidu Cloud's AI-powered tools assist in medical image analysis, disease diagnosis, and drug discovery. In the finance sector, its AI capabilities are used for fraud detection, risk management, and personalized financial services. Furthermore, its contributions to autonomous driving and smart city initiatives demonstrate the wide-ranging applicability of its cloud-based AI solutions.

The market position of Baidu Cloud within China is strong, although it faces stiff competition from Alibaba Cloud (Aliyun) and Tencent Cloud. While Alibaba Cloud currently holds the largest market share, Baidu Cloud occupies a significant portion, particularly in areas where its AI strengths provide a competitive edge. The Chinese cloud computing market is experiencing explosive growth, driven by the increasing adoption of digital technologies across various sectors. This growth provides substantial opportunities for Baidu Cloud to expand its market share and solidify its position as a major player.

However, Baidu Cloud also faces several challenges. The highly competitive landscape necessitates continuous innovation and investment in its infrastructure and services to remain competitive. Maintaining data security and privacy is also crucial, particularly given the increasing regulatory scrutiny surrounding data management in China. Furthermore, expanding its international reach beyond its dominant position in the Chinese market presents a significant challenge, requiring strategic partnerships and adaptation to diverse international regulations and business practices.

In terms of technological strengths, Baidu Cloud benefits from Baidu's extensive research and development capabilities in areas like AI, big data, and distributed systems. Its robust infrastructure, built upon years of experience in managing large-scale data centers, provides a solid foundation for its cloud services. Furthermore, its commitment to open-source technologies and collaborations with other industry players fosters innovation and enhances the capabilities of its platform.
